@JustinBleuel@mweinbach Blocks are useful, but they are not a replacement for Canvas.
Blocks work well for quick draft snippets. Canvas is what makes serious multi-turn editing, stable longform revision, and “discuss then apply” workflows possible.
Canvas should be retained and improved, not replaced.
@JustinBleuel@mweinbach With blocks, chat and editing are separated. You can discuss in chat or edit in the block, but not integrate the two around the same document. That’s a real regression from canvas.
@JustinBleuel@mweinbach The current diff only exists before applying changes. Once accepted, there is no persistent show-changes view against the prior state. The only option is to toggle between undo and redo and manually work out the difference. This is a major downgrade in function from Show changes
@JustinBleuel@mweinbach Undo is not previous version parity. Canvas let me move through previous states with Show changes on and see what changed across iterations. Blocks don’t preserve that workflow. That’s a real downgrade among many others
